WebMar 8, 2012 · Establishing Curfew Rules. our tween is growing up, and that means your child is learning how to make decisions and develop a … WebSep 22, 2024 · Link Rules to Consequences . Both the rule and the consequence should be specific.   For example, a family rule might be that the teen has an 11:00 p.m. curfew on a weekend night. When the rule is established, set the consequence—like being grounded from friends for the next two weekends.
